The original color palette of Bloodhounds is gritty and realistic. For stylized fan edits, creators apply custom LUTs (Look-Up Tables) to boost contrast, deepen the blacks, and enhance the saturation of skin tones and neon lights. Adding subtle motion blur (RSMB), localized glow effects, and sharpening passes completes the high-velocity, modern edit look.

Netflix streams Bloodhounds at standard cinematic frame rates (usually 23.976 or 24 frames per second). To make a "smooth" slow-motion clip, Twixtor must calculate the missing frames. Editors look for clips with clean backgrounds so the software doesn't create "warping" artifacts around Woo Do-hwan’s silhouette during rapid movement. 2. Velocity Ramping

Before diving into the specific scenes that fans are obsessing over, it is important to understand the digital magic behind these clips. is a high-end, third-party software plugin often used by video editors in After Effects to alter the frame rate of a video. By intelligently calculating and generating new frames between the original ones, editors can slow down footage to an incredibly smooth, fluid degree without the typical choppiness or blurring usually seen in standard slow-motion.
